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5143055 522 79834
59 4385254245
59 4385254245
2003 9224 78506069302
All about undefined
Interested in learning more?
59 4385254245
2003 9224 78506069302
See more
89277 75615709010
8009 14687462555 78099596738
See more
017386994 10912998
1266 8657911 1172
See more